Visiting the Historic Summer Residence of the Popes

The Apostolic Palace of Castel Gandolfo is the site of the popes’ summer residence, making it a significant location in papal history. Visitors gain entry to the main rooms of the Palace, where the story of papal ceremonies and daily life is told through artistic details and historical rooms. The digital guide enhances this experience by providing context for each space, ensuring visitors understand the importance of what they see without the need for a physical guide.

The Palace overlooks the landscape of the Castelli Romani, offering impressive panoramic views of Lake Albano. The rooms themselves display a mixture of historical artifacts and artistic features, providing a glimpse into the papal lifestyle during summer months. Practical Details and Meeting Point

The tour begins at the main entrance of the Papal Palace of Castel Gandolfo, with the meeting point located at coordinates 41.747169494628906, 12.650283813476562. Participants are asked to show their booking voucher to the reception 15 minutes before the scheduled start time. The process to access the Palace is stress-free—simply presenting the digital ticket allows entry, avoiding long lines or complicated procedures.

The group size is limited to 10 participants, encouraging a more intimate experience. The small group environment also helps ensure that visitors can easily consult the digital guide and enjoy the experience without feeling rushed or overwhelmed.
